About this experience

Discover the Luštica Peninsula—the greenest jewel of Boka Bay, where donkeys roam freely, olive trees flourish, and the sun seems to shine without end. Although located close to the bustling town of Kotor, Luštica feels like a world of its own—peaceful, authentic, and deeply connected to nature.
Stroll through traditional stone villages and take in panoramic views that capture the true spirit of the Mediterranean—simple, serene, and timeless. As part of this experience, you will visit a local village and a charming rural household, where an old olive mill tells stories of generations past. Meet a warm and welcoming family whose roots run deep in this land, and discover how tradition continues to live on through their way of life. You will have the opportunity to sample local prosciutto, cheese, and other homemade delights, while enjoying the pleasant atmosphere of their inviting household.
After the lunch you will stroll though the old town Kotor and learn about it's rich history.

About Kotor

Kotor is a historic coastal town in Montenegro, known for its stunning natural beauty and medieval architecture. Nestled in a fjord-like bay, it offers breathtaking views, ancient walls, and a rich cultural heritage.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Black Risotto

A traditional dish made with cuttlefish, giving it a unique black color.

Main Course Contains seafood, gluten (from rice)

Kotor Ham

A cured ham with a distinctive flavor, often served with local cheese.

Appetizer Contains pork

Kotor Pasticada

A slow-cooked beef dish with a rich tomato and wine sauce, served with gnocchi.

Main Course Contains beef, gluten (from gnocchi)

Pro tips

  • Visit Kotor Fortress early in the morning or late in the afternoon to avoid the heat and crowds.
  • Take a boat tour of the Bay of Kotor for stunning views and a unique perspective.
  • Explore the local markets for fresh produce, souvenirs, and traditional crafts.
  • Try local specialties like black risotto and Kotor ham for an authentic culinary experience.
